Windows服务除了可以在“服务”组件可视化的管理配置外,也可通过 net
和 sc
工具进行管理。
net
控制服务的启停
启动服务
net start servicename
停止服务
net start servicename
servicename
对每个服务是唯一的,类似ID的作用,而非服务的显示名称。
直接输入net
可获得使用提示。
sc
管理服务
创建服务
sc create servicename binPath=C:\path\to\exe
删除服务
sc delete servicename
激活服务
sc config servicename start= demand
禁用服务
sc config servicename start= disabled
重启时自动运行服务
sc config servicename start= auto
sc
和net
一样也可用于控制服务的启停
启动服务
sc start servicename
停止服务
sc stop servicename
=
后面的空格时必须的。如果当前用户没有管理员权限,会提示权限不足。
直接输入sc
可获得使用提示。